An interview with Kevin Smith, co-founder of Splash News, the Los Angeles-based news and picture agency that acts for celebrity-snapping paparazzi, dealt only with copyright matters. Smith explained the problems he faces with bloggers who dare to use his agency's images. That's all very well, but I so wish he had also been asked about the ethics involved in obtaining those images in the first place. A missed opportunity, I'm afraid. (Via journalism.co.uk)
